Notes on the Usefulness of Measures of Dispersion

It is helpful for determining the reliability of an average. It points out the extent to which the average is the representative of the entire data. It enables comparison of two or more distributions with regard to their variability.

What is the usefulness of Ocean Tides?

Every 24 hours, the waters of the ocean rise and fall alternately. This alternate rise and fall in the sea level is known as ‘tide’. The rise of the sea level is called high tide or ‘flow’ and at its lowest point, it is called low tide or ‘ebb’.
